The Sierra Nevada Dog Drivers just announced its annual
introductory mushing clinic. They're an excellent club, and
MUSH! is certainly one of the best introductory books out
there.

--------
Here's a chance for those folks that are interested in learning about
dog driving (mushing). Its also a great time to refresh your skills
for people new to the sport. You need not even own a dog to have a
great time.

Sierra Nevada Dog Drivers proudly presents the 7th annual

INTRODUCTION TO MUSHING FOR DOG AND DRIVER

This weekend event is an opportunity to have hands-on rig, scooter,
sled and skijor dog training from some of California's top dog
drivers & trainers including International Sled Dog Racing Association
medalists! You will receive one-on-one personalized training as well
as group instruction and have the opportunity to watch experienced dog
teams in action! If you don't have any equipment, no problem, SNDD
will supply the equipment, you supply the dogs! (All breeds of dogs
are welcome! and NO experience is necessary).

If you have your own equipment, feel free to bring it with you.

Date: October 23rd & 24thth, 2004

Place: Truckee, CA

Cost: $110 per person. (This price includes a complimentary copy of
SNDD's Mush! A Beginner's Manual of Sled Dog Training, edited by SNDD
member Bella Levorsen, and Saturday night dinner for the participant,
guests may attend dinner for $10 additional per guest.)
